The application provides a gas conveying pipeline fine water mist explosion-proof device, which comprises a long
pipe, a plurality of atomizing nozzles, a
communicating cavity arranged in the long
pipe, a
water pipe communicated with one end of the
communicating cavity, and a drainage cleaning mechanism arranged on the arc surface of the long
pipe. The drainage cleaning mechanism comprises a leakage hole, a cylinder and a
fan blade assembly. The leakage hole is arranged on the arc surface of the long pipe, the cylinder is inserted into the leakage hole, and the
fan blade assembly is arranged in the cylinder. The arc surface of the long pipe is provided with a square hole. The gas in the pipeline is sprayed by the atomizing nozzles, so that the concentration of the gas is reduced, and the
gas explosion is prevented to a certain extent. The water in the pipeline is discharged through the cylinder and the leakage hole, so that the rusting of the pipeline caused by excessive water in the pipeline is avoided.
